i would like to know if its possible to have ubuntu fonts in n900 and how to get them in my device,
 
qwazix's Avatar
Posts: 2,256 | Thanked: 4,044 times | Joined on Jan 2010
#2
It is possible. Point your browser to http://font.ubuntu.com/ on the N900 and download them. Then unpack them using file-roller and copy them to /home/user/.fonts or /usr/share/fonts and use theme customizer to apply them to the interface, or just use them in applications
